Bankroll Management Techniques
Effective bankroll management is essential for any player aiming for long-term success in a casino setting. This involves setting a budget and sticking to it, regardless of wins or losses. A well-defined bankroll allows players to enjoy their gaming experience without the stress of financial strain. It’s crucial to determine beforehand how much one is willing to lose and to make decisions accordingly.
Moreover, players should consider dividing their bankroll into smaller amounts for each gaming session. This technique not only prolongs playtime but also minimizes the risk of substantial losses. By managing a bankroll wisely, players can maintain control over their gambling habits and increase their chances of walking away with profits.
Adapting to Game Variations
Many casino games come with various versions, each offering distinct rules and strategies that can significantly affect the outcome. For example, blackjack has multiple variations such as European, American, and Spanish, each with different house edges. Understanding these variations can provide players with insights that lead to more effective strategies tailored to the specific rules of the game they’re playing.
Players should not only familiarize themselves with the common strategies for each version but also remain adaptable, adjusting their approach based on the particularities of the game they’re participating in. This flexibility is key to maximizing potential returns while minimizing losses.
Psychological Aspects of Gambling
The psychological component of gambling is often underestimated. Understanding one’s emotions and responses when winning or losing can significantly influence gameplay. Many successful players advocate for maintaining a calm demeanor, as emotional decision-making can lead to impulsive bets and increased risks. Adopting a disciplined mindset is crucial for executing well-thought-out strategies.
Additionally, recognizing the common psychological traps, such as the illusion of control or the gambler’s fallacy, can help players make more rational choices. Developing a strong mental approach empowers gamblers to implement their strategies more effectively and to enjoy the experience without succumbing to stress or frustration.
